How Phoenix Issues Shape Your Electric System

The environment below presses materials to their limits. Copper expands and contracts with large temperature level swings, lug links loosen a little year over year, and UV direct exposure eats away at wire insulation on outside runs that were not protected appropriately. In older homes, light weight aluminum branch circuits from the 1960s and early 1970s can make complex matters. These systems can be made safe with the right adapters and techniques, yet only if a professional understands the equipment, the history, and our local code amendments.

Monsoon season includes another layer. A quick thunderstorm can create voltage spikes. Without correct rise security at the solution and point-of-use defense at delicate tools, you take the chance of silent damage to home appliances. I have seen new heatpump degrade in a single season since rise danger was ignored. The repair costs much less than a compressor replacement.

Finally, Phoenix's quick growth suggests many homes obtained piecemeal additions. Removed garages wired by a useful uncle in 1998, patio area electrical outlets daisy-chained off old circuits, EV battery chargers included in panels that had no ability to save. None of these problems are uncommon. They simply require an organized approach.

Common Electrical Repair Phoenix Jobs, and Just How Pros Detect Them

Repairs commonly start with symptoms that look trivial. A light that hums, a breaker that journeys now and then, an electrical outlet that feels cozy. In Phoenix az we see a pattern of issues tied to warmth cycling and aging components.

Loose neutral connections show up as dimming lights when a motor begins, or arbitrary flickers. The neutral bar in your panel can loosen in time, and the exact same happens at tool backstabs that were never tightened up appropriately. Backstabs conserve a min during first mount but age inadequately. We relocate connections to screw terminals, torque them to spec, and examination under load.

Breaker exhaustion is real. Thermal-magnetic breakers take care of thousands of little warmth cycles. In a panel that beings in a warm garage, those cycles multiply. If a breaker trips at moderate lots, it may be worn out instead of overloaded. Substitute is uncomplicated, though we validate the circuit's true draw with a clamp meter prior to exchanging parts. If a dual-function breaker (GFCI plus AFCI) trips periodically, it may be reacting to a genuine arc mistake from a nicked conductor or an affordable plug strip. We chase after the mistake instead of masking it.

Exterior receptacles and illumination boxes commonly shed their climate seals. UV turns gaskets weak, then the very first monsoon drives moisture within. GFCIs need to journey, and if they do not, that is a larger problem. A fast get in touch with a top quality tester, brand-new in-use covers, and correct caulking against stucco stop most water intrusion concerns. When rust has actually taken hold, we change the device and wire nuts, and if needed, the box.

Attic splices from old satellite installs or DIY followers are another Phoenix unique. Loose wirenuts buried in blown-in insulation are a fire risk. A complete repair includes locating joint factors, setting up accepted junction boxes with covers, stress alleviating the conductors, and recording places for future inspection.

Planning Residential Electrical Services Phoenix Homes Demand for the Next Decade

An excellent strategy straightens with your lifestyle and the city's energy profile. Utility rates, discount possibilities, and grid stress shape what makes good sense. As more homeowners add EVs and heatpump, lots management becomes critical. You can stay clear of a complete upgrade if you organize huge tons with a wise panel or a simple load-shedding device. As an example, you can set up a 50-amp EV battery charger that pauses when the electrical stove and clothes dryer run together, then returns to billing over night. It is undetectable in operation and can conserve thousands on a utility-side service upgrade.

Surge protection is no longer optional. Whole-home units at the main panel guard pricey electronics and a/c boards. Try to find tools with a clear standing sign and a joule score that matches your service. Set that with point-of-use strips for computers and home entertainment facilities. After any type of substantial surge, check the condition lights. I recommend clients to photo the panel device's sign when it is brand-new, then compare after huge storms.

Grounding and bonding should have a fresh appearance on homes developed before the 1990s. Gradually, ground poles corrode, clamps loosen up, and additional bonds to copper water piping are lost during pipes job. A quick audit verifies connection and maintains fault currents on the path they belong. This is one of those work that prevents issues you never see.

Lighting is a very easy win. High-CRI LED fixtures enhance convenience, reduce heat load, and cut expenses. In cooking areas, set cozy task lighting with cooler ambient trims to maintain colors real on food and surface areas. Outdoors, tranquil the bright-hot Phoenix evening with secured, color-appropriate fixtures that satisfy dark-sky perceptiveness and prevent annoying neighbors.

Remodels, Enhancements, and Service Upgrades: Where Scope Creep Hides

In remodels, electric job typically discloses shocks. When we open up a wall surface, we sometimes find a joint concealed without a box, or multiple circuits feeding a single outlet. Great electrical experts flag these as safety and security corrections and fold them into the extent with clear prices. If your specialist stands up to change orders on buried risks, that is a red flag. It is far better to pause a day, fix it right, and proceed with confidence than to bury an issue again.

Service upgrades require thoughtful justification. Not every home needs to jump from 100 amps to 200. A load computation levels. For many Phoenix homes, a 125-amp or 150-amp service satisfies demands when coupled with smart tons monitoring. On the various other hand, if you plan a swimming pool heat pump, two EVs, and a workshop with a 5-hp dirt enthusiast, plan for 200 amps and space for future breakers. Coordinate with the energy for meter draws and schedule around assessment windows. In summer season, staffs usually organize the upgrade early in the early morning to restrict time without AC.

Safety and Code: Practical, Not Pedantic

Code is not a list of hoops to jump with. It is the cumulative memory of mistakes the profession has actually discovered not to repeat. Arizona complies with the National Electric Code with local changes. In Phoenix metro, inspectors watch carefully for arc-fault security in habitable spaces, tamper-resistant receptacles, GFCI in garages and outdoors, and correct assistance and protection of NM cable. Installments that work great on the first day can still fall short inspection if a staple is missing or a box fill mores than ability. A top-rated electrical contractor recognizes where these details live and gets them right the very first time.

Aluminum wiring, common in specific eras, can be safe if repaired and kept with the ideal connectors and antioxidant substance. The trick is to stay clear of mixed-metal terminations not rated for it. I have actually seen scorched gadgets where a well-meaning owner swapped a receptacle without recognizing the conductor was aluminum. If your home has light weight aluminum branch circuits, go over COPALUM or AlumiConn repair services with your electrical expert. Both have record when mounted correctly.

DIY fits. Exchanging a dead GFCI in a bathroom, if you recognize exactly how to turn off the best breaker and confirm power is off, can be uncomplicated. But the minute a junction box holds greater than two or 3 cables, or the device sits in a cooking area, garage, or outside area with added code needs, the risk of a subtle blunder increases. An electrician near me Phoenix search deserves your time if you feel any type of unpredictability. A one-hour service telephone call is more affordable than a fire.

EV Chargers, Solar, and Battery Storage Space: Integrating New Loads the Smart Way

EV battery chargers are one of the most asked for additions currently. A 240-volt, 50-amp circuit is common, yet not always required. Lots of owners charge over night on a 30- or 40-amp circuit and wake to a full battery. Smart chargers can throttle draw to match readily available capability, which often prevents a panel upgrade. A skilled electrician Phoenix home owners employ will certainly examine your panel, your everyday driving, and your home's lots profile before advising a size.

Solar complicates the panel picture. Backfeed guidelines limit how much solar you can connect into a given bus. In some cases a line-side faucet or a panel with greater bus ranking solves the math. Occasionally a brand-new primary breaker with decreased amperage on a panel that still supports your actual load opens up room for solar backfeed. These are code-intensive choices, the kind you want a seasoned electrical contractor and solar designer to handle together.

Battery storage space adds weight to the wall surface, brand-new disconnects, and sequence-of-operations demands. Your electrician needs to plan clear labeling, emergency situation shutoffs, and a design that service technologies can navigate without uncertainty. In a hot Phoenix metro garage, ample spacing and ventilation for equipment are crucial.

When to Ask for Emergency Situation Electrical Services Phoenix Residents Can Trust

If you scent melting plastic near a panel or electrical outlet, if a breaker trips right away and will not reset, or if a section of your home has power while adjacent rooms do not, call. Warm or discolored outlets, crackling sounds, and repeated shocks from home appliances are non-negotiable red flags. A calm, methodical electrician will isolate damaged circuits, confirm tight links with torque devices, and replace harmed components right now. Do not wait for a practical time. Electrical troubles do not repair themselves, they grow.
